Hilton Head Wellness Guide: Local Tips for Active Living

South Carolina’s Hilton Head Island is widely known for its beautiful beaches and world-class golf, but it’s also an excellent destination for health and fitness. At Hilton Head Health (H3), visitors can start the New Year with a focused program to improve their fitness, nutrition and golf skills. Led by Keith Bach, director of golf instruction, and Danielle Dunn, fitness director, H3’s golf, fitness and nutrition offerings are designed to refine eating habits and elevate on-course performance through a balanced combination of classes and personalized coaching.

The H3 curriculum includes Pilates for Flexibility, golf-specific conditioning and yoga, all aimed at improving core strength, flexibility and balance. Personal trainers assess each guest and design individualized plans to target specific needs, whether that means increasing mobility, preventing injury or optimizing swing mechanics. Guests receive a comprehensive health assessment on arrival and enjoy unlimited access to more than 20 fitness classes daily. The program also features group discussions, seminars and cooking demonstrations that teach practical nutrition strategies and healthier meal preparation.

Golf instruction at H3 focuses on fundamental swing theory and the technical adjustments each player requires. Keith Bach and the golf team provide daily on-course sessions to help golfers apply lessons in real playing conditions. Participants can choose from private lessons, group clinics and three-day golf schools to match their goals and skill levels.

Executive Chef Jennifer Welper oversees H3’s culinary program, bringing formal culinary nutrition training from Johnson & Wales University and Certified Executive Chef credentials from the American Culinary Federation. The food program emphasizes gourmet spa cuisine that supports wellness goals while remaining flavorful and satisfying, with balanced meals tailored to the program’s nutritional principles.

The 800-acre gated resort sits within Shipyard Plantation and offers a range of accommodations from private rooms to two- and three-bedroom condominiums. Programs run year-round, and pricing varies according to program length and accommodation choice.
